Declassified documents of the US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) have revealed that former President of Mexico, José López Portillo, who led the country during 1976-1982, was a CIA asset. The revelation comes as part of a new batch of declassified documents published by the US National Archives.

A Latino Alt-Right? This Is How Vox Advances In Latin America
In Mexico, he has already had the support of several congressmen. The Spanish party received the support of 15 senators and three congressmen from the traditional National Action Party (PAN) and the Institutional Revolutionary Party (PRI).
But Mexico is not the only Latin American country where the right has already established ties with the Abascal movement. In Colombia, several politicians of the right-wing within Uribismo, see in Vox a model of a party more suitable to their ideology. Characters such as María Fernanda Cabal, a presidential candidate, are close to Trumpism and the Spanish right. She shares the idea of creating a common front against international progressivism and sees in Vox an ideal ally.

Likewise, they have also tried to open relations in Peru with the Popular Force party of the controversial Keiko Fujimori. The Vox delegation was attended by its vice president and deputy, Víctor González, MEP Hermann Tertsch and the director of the Disenso Foundation, Jorge Martín Frías.
